Clinical Operations is part of Clinical Development. Clinical Development is responsible for end-to-end clinical project activities, including clinical operations, medical writing, biostatistics, data management, clinical science and clinical pharmacology. We are responsible for both human and veterinary clinical trial activities within our clinical pipeline.

ABOUT THE JOB


In the position you will work closely with Clinical Trial Managers (CTM) and the Director of Clinical Operations to manage our portfolio of clinical studies, and you will have a close working relation to our Clinical Process Manager to manage day-to-day tasks related to our study Trial Master Files.  You will take a key role in managing of documents and contracts related to our clinical trials and you will support the department in a number of different tasks as detailed below. In the role you will work with external partners, CROs/vendors and KOLs to ensure smooth operations of daily activities.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ES


  • Trial Master File development and maintenance including training of and support to CTMs
  • Document flow, review, QC and filing/archiving of trial related documents in the TMF including collection from vendors (both paper and e-CRFs), quality and completeness processes and archiving
  • Supporting the CTMs in operational aspects related to trial planning, conduct and closure to ensure compliance and quality of the clinical trials
  • Working with external partners, CROs/vendors and KOLs to support document flow
  • Assist the CTMs with Sponsor oversight, study specific documentation review, tracking and QC
  • Liase with CROs for task follow up
  • Supporting setup of contracts (CDAs, consultancy agreements etc.) with KOLs, contractors, vendors etc, including follow-up on FMV evaluations, and management of documents in our contracts management system
  • Driving workflow related to our data processing agreements and DPIA assessments
  • Driving compliance tasks related to vendor oversight, IT aspects, KOL reporting requirements etc.
  • Attend internal team meetings and generate meeting agenda and minutes when needed
  • General document management and archiving tasks

About Pharmacosmos


Headquartered in Denmark, Pharmacosmos is a family-owned, international healthcare company with more than 50 years of innovation and leadership in iron- and carbohydrate-based treatments and solutions for human and animal use.

A research-based company, its ongoing R&D programme focuses on improving the lives of patients with iron deficiency with or without anaemia. More than 1 billion people live with iron deficiency anaemia and it is the leading cause of death for an estimated 180,000 people every year. This makes it one of the largest global health challenges of our time.

Pharmacosmos has subsidiaries in US, China, UK, Ireland, Germany, Sweden and Norway and its products are marketed in more than 80 countries around the world. Its manufacturing facilities are approved, among others, by the Danish Medicines Agency and the US FDA.
